开发过程中在一些网址上携带参数较多,每次从路径上获取数据太麻烦,不如将其封装成对象,这样页面初始化后,每次使用路径上的参数只需调用封装的对象即可,这里有一个将路径参数封装成对象的方法,非常简便实用,屡试不爽!
//将路径上的参数封装成对象 getUrlObj(){ let url = window.location.href.split("?")[1]; /* 获取完整URL */ let arr=url.split("&"); let obj={}; for(let i=0;i<arr.length;i++){ let g=arr[i].split("="); obj[g[0]]=g[1]; } this.urlObj=obj; return obj; },
========================================================
关闭当前页面
closeView() { var userAgent = navigator.userAgent; if ( userAgent.indexOf("Firefox") != -1 || userAgent.indexOf("Chrome") != -1 ) { window.location.href = "about:blank"; window.open("", "_self").close(); } else { window.opener = null; window.open("about:blank", "_self"); window.close(); } },
element UI将表格表头用斜线分割
Vue ElementUI table实现给表格一个单元格斜线分隔线 - 心中Where_True循环 - 博客园 (cnblogs.com)